About Copacetic: The 3D Pipes screensaver, but a resource management game, inside of a cube, about genocide. Place factories and modules around the walls of your mind, avoiding tangles as you wire them all together. Travel across the galaxy harvesting all sentient life. Space is limited, and the only enemy is you.
